
In this episode of The Alcohol-Free Rebellion, host Abby Calabrese sits down with Jess Smith—a former school principal turned life coach—for a powerful conversation about redefining success, sobriety, and self-worth.
Jess shares her personal journey from "responsible drinking" to realizing alcohol was masking deeper struggles, and how stepping away from it became a gateway to radical self-awareness and growth. Abby and Jess reflect on their experience at the Sober Mom Life Retreat, the unique challenges high-achieving women face in sobriety, and how to navigate relationships, careers, and identity without alcohol.
They explore the intersection of fitness, mindset, and sobriety; the emotional rollercoaster of early alcohol-free living; and why letting go of guilt and shame is essential for true freedom.
